>Because SMS with unicode contains only 70 characters. (That is why I
>do not like Unicode, at least.) Andreas, is coding of greek chars with
>GSM default alphabet standardised any way ?
>

Dont know really but the code I was referred to was:

http://www.dreamfabric.com/sms/default_alphabet.html

My approach would be to do a ISO8859-1 mapping to GSM alphabeth and a 
ISO8859-5 mapping to GSM alphabeth. However current SMSC code does 
only use  ISO8859-1 all the way.
